Transaction e6455a417566ddd6dba72ec1fe78bcd43d64ac63af3d07f9bbb5d6801bfc25f6
1 Input
1 Output
-
e6455a417566ddd6dba72ec1fe78bcd43d64ac63af3d07f9bbb5d6801bfc25f6:0
- value
- 28425150
- script pubkey
- OP_0 OP_PUSHBYTES_20 81fe22a7ed491ff0c33509420af07b85e42c8371
- address
- bc1qs8lz9fldfy0lpse4p9pq4urmshjzeqm3mywels